Output 8fe76ba3ca03e35def602669198bbb442c73fa653f77499af660430fd9ab9a00:1

value
51189
script pubkey
OP_0 OP_PUSHBYTES_20 f74913c808c1145be26863e9a6be44129d3aa21e
address
bc1q7ay38jqgcy29hcngv056d0jyz2wn4gs7d93x0v
transaction
8fe76ba3ca03e35def602669198bbb442c73fa653f77499af660430fd9ab9a00
confirmations
64012
spent
true